What are the responsibilities and job description for the Certified Peer Recovery Specialist position at Pyramid Healthcare?

Our Certified Recovery Specialists assist our clients in developing and solidifying long-term recovery supports and providing services before, during and following an individual’s engagement in the treatment continuum. Pyramid Healthcare in California, Maryland offers outpatient treatment and intensive outpatient treatment (IOP) for men and women with substance use disorders, mental health disorders, co-occurring disorders and problem gambling. We also provide psychiatric services for clients who require medication management! Rather than relying on a one-size-fits-all approach, we strive to customize our treatment plans on the needs of each client through groups or individual sessions, collaborating as needed to create comprehensive and individualized treatment plans.

Deliverables

• Provides opportunities for individuals to direct their own recovery plan and supports, build self-worth, wellness, empowerment and self-advocacy.
• Work with the individual’s family, service and treatment providers, other programs and community supports to assist in achievement of goals.
• Conducts regularly scheduled sessions with individuals and motivates them to identify interests, strengths, and goals which promote a lifestyle of recovery
• Attends and participates in treatment team meetings whenever possible while providing feedback regarding the individual’s recovery perspective.
• Introduce and engage individuals in the recovery community including sober social and recreational activities.
• Promoting community integration through the connection of resources, linking to supports, mutual-help groups, social clubs, volunteer and job opportunities.
• Maintains accurate documentation regarding the individual’s progress, goals, challenges, and utilization of skills and support.
• Other duties as assigned.

Licensure, Education, & Experience:
• Certified Peer Recovery Specialist (CPRS) certification in state of Maryland.
• Valid driver’s license with clean driving history & willingness to travel locally.
